Express Media's quote on the two single-fold cover version (2 17x11 single-folds, 4/1 on 10pt C1S, scored and folded to 8.5x11, with a 32-page, 60# saddle-stitch B&W booklet) was $2.45 apiece; this was for an order of 100 copies for each of 6 different module-packages. Shrinkwrapping would add 15 cents per package.

This price includes their assembly of the package (putting the booklets inside the covers), since I forgot to specify otherwise. The comparison quote for a traditional version of this order (just one cover saddle-stitched to the booklet) was $1.44, so the cost of two detached covers without assembly would be somewhere between those figures.

This is much better than I had tentatively budgeted for, both in terms of cost and speed! Their representative was very friendly over the phone and helpful to a newbie like myself, and seemed pleased to hear that Adept Press had highly recommended Express Media's services.
